The best mesothelioma lawyers are licensed in a variety of states. They will have years of experience working with each state's legal system and can determine the best jurisdiction to file your case.

These companies will also be familiar with the local statutes of limitations and mesothelioma laws. This allows them to file your lawsuit within the stipulated timeframe to ensure that you have a high chance of recovering compensation.

In New York, the asbestos settlement statute of limitations is three years from the date of diagnosis for personal injury cases, and two years from the date of death for claims based on wrongful deaths. The statute of limitations in each state regulates the time period that an individual has to apply for compensation. If the statute of limitations passes and you are not eligible to seek compensation for your injuries or illness.

The top mesothelioma lawyers know the various statutes and how they are applied to specific circumstances. They will ensure your case is filed before the deadline. They will also assist you in exploring alternatives to compensation, such as trust fund lawsuits.

The time-limit for asbestos-related lawsuits is determined by many factors. The nature of the claim, for instance, will determine the time the clock begins to run. This applies to personal injury as well as the cases of wrongful deaths. In addition, the location where you filed your claim could affect the statute of limitations. This could be because of the location where you were exposed to asbestos, the place you currently live or where the headquarters of the asbestos company are in.

A mesothelioma lawsuit can be filed either by the surviving family members of a deceased victim or by the sufferer of the disease themselves. The surviving family members of a victim who has died are able to file wrongful-death cases. These cases may include the payment of funeral expenses, medical bills, and loss of companionship.
